What is the NFHS Football Rule Book?

The NFHS Football Rule Book is the official rule book for high school football in the United States. Published annually by the National Federation of State High School Associations (NFHS), it outlines all the regulations, guidelines, and interpretations that govern the sport at the high school level. This rule book isn't just a set of guidelines; it's the foundation upon which fair play, player safety, and consistent officiating are built. It covers everything from player equipment and field specifications to game procedures, penalties, and scoring. Basically, if it happens on a high school football field, the NFHS rule book has something to say about it.

Why is the NFHS Rule Book Important?

The NFHS rule book plays several vital roles in high school football:

  • Ensuring Fair Play: By providing a consistent set of rules, the NFHS rule book helps ensure that all teams compete on a level playing field. This standardization minimizes discrepancies and promotes fairness across different states and regions.
  • Promoting Player Safety: Player safety is a top priority in football, and the NFHS rule book reflects this. It includes rules and guidelines designed to reduce the risk of injuries, such as those related to tackling, blocking, and concussion protocols. These rules are regularly updated to reflect the latest research and best practices in sports medicine.
  • Guiding Coaches and Players: The rule book serves as an indispensable resource for coaches and players, helping them understand the intricacies of the game and avoid penalties. It clarifies what is legal and illegal, ensuring that everyone is on the same page.
  • Aiding Officials: Referees rely on the NFHS rule book to make accurate and consistent calls during games. The rule book provides clear interpretations of various scenarios, helping officials apply the rules correctly and maintain control of the game.
  • Supporting Administrators: School administrators and athletic directors use the NFHS rule book to ensure that their football programs comply with national standards. This helps them create a safe and positive environment for student-athletes.

Key Sections of the NFHS Football Rule Book

Alright, let's take a quick tour of some of the most important sections you'll find in the NFHS Football Rule Book. Understanding these key areas will give you a solid foundation for navigating the entire document.

  1. Rules Governing the Game: This section covers the fundamental rules of football, including scoring, timing, player conduct, and game administration. You'll find details on everything from how many points a touchdown is worth to how long each quarter lasts.
  2. Player Equipment: Ensuring that players have the right equipment and that it meets safety standards is crucial. This section outlines the requirements for helmets, pads, and other protective gear. It also addresses what types of equipment are legal and illegal.
  3. Field Regulations: The dimensions and markings of the football field are standardized to ensure consistency across all games. This section specifies the exact measurements for the field, end zones, and goalposts.
  4. Penalties: Penalties are an inevitable part of football, and understanding them is key to avoiding costly mistakes. This section details the various penalties that can be assessed during a game, along with their corresponding yardage implications.
  5. Officiating: This section explains the roles and responsibilities of the game officials, as well as the procedures they must follow when making calls. It helps ensure that games are officiated fairly and consistently.
  6. Definitions: Football has its own unique vocabulary, and this section provides clear definitions of key terms and concepts. This is an invaluable resource for anyone who is new to the game or wants to brush up on their knowledge.

Tips for Using the NFHS Football Rule Book Effectively

Alright, you've got your hands on the NFHS Football Rule Book PDF. Awesome! But simply having the rule book isn't enough. You need to know how to use it effectively to get the most out of it. Here are a few tips to help you:

  • Read It Cover to Cover: It might seem daunting, but reading the entire rule book is the best way to gain a comprehensive understanding of the game. Take your time and break it down into manageable sections.
  • Highlight and Annotate: As you read, highlight key points and make notes in the margins. This will help you remember important rules and interpretations. Use different colors for different categories, such as penalties, equipment, and game procedures.
  • Use the Index: The index is your best friend when you need to quickly find information on a specific topic. Use it to locate the relevant sections of the rule book when you have a question about a particular rule or situation.
  • Study the Case Book: The NFHS also publishes a case book, which provides detailed explanations of various scenarios and how the rules apply to them. Studying the case book will help you develop a deeper understanding of the rules and how they are interpreted in real-game situations.
  • Attend Training Sessions: Many state high school associations offer training sessions for coaches and officials. Attending these sessions is a great way to learn more about the rules and ask questions from experts.
  • Stay Up-to-Date: The NFHS Football Rule Book is updated annually, so it's important to stay current with the latest changes. Make sure you have the most recent version of the rule book and review any updates or revisions.

Common Misconceptions About the NFHS Football Rule Book

Before we wrap up, let's clear up a few common misconceptions about the NFHS Football Rule Book.

  • It's Only for Referees: While referees certainly rely on the rule book, it's an invaluable resource for anyone involved in high school football, including players, coaches, and administrators.
  • It's Too Complicated to Understand: The rule book can seem daunting at first, but it's actually quite well-organized and clearly written. By breaking it down into manageable sections and using the index, you can easily find the information you need.
  • The Rules Never Change: The NFHS Football Rule Book is updated annually to reflect changes in the game and address emerging safety concerns. It's important to stay current with the latest revisions.
  • It's the Same as College or NFL Rules: While there are some similarities, the NFHS rules differ in many ways from those used in college or professional football. Make sure you're familiar with the specific rules that apply to high school football.
